A newly leaked image has sparked excitement by hinting at a bronze titanium color option for the iPhone 16 Pro. This addition comes amidst ongoing speculation about the phone’s color range.
The rumor about a bronze shade first surfaced in late July 2024, when Weibo user "Fixed Focus Digital" described it as "especially like bronze." Previously, this leaker suggested colors including green, white, and purple, while many other sources expect a rose-colored option.
The latest leak, shared by Sonny Dickson, presents an image featuring bronze, white, black, and gray colors. Notably, the black color shown in this leak appears to be a deeper, more intense shade compared to previous versions.
Apple currently offers four colors for its iPhone 16 Pro and iPhone 16 Pro Max, and while there’s no confirmation that these leaked colors will be the final choices, they provide a glimpse into possible options.
Sonny Dickson, known for focusing on color leaks, has a strong track record. His earlier leaks also indicated that the iPhone 16 Pro might feature a new Capture button. Apple is expected to unveil the iPhone 16 Pro and iPhone 16 Pro Max at a September event.
